Everything You Have To Know About Credit Repair

There are millions of bad credit scores out there today. It’s no surprise, not with a poor economy, rising living costs, stagnant wages, and a nasty employment market. These tips can save you from that and improve your credit score.

When you have better credit, you will be offered lower interest rates on loans and credit cards. Lower interest rates mean lower payments, which allows you to pay off debt faster. Compare offers and choose the best interest rate you can find when borrowing money or subscribing to a credit card.

Make sure that you are never using more than 50% of your credit card’s limit. Credit card balances are among the factors taken into account when determining your credit score. Maintaining balances over 50% will lower your rating. You can attain lower your balances by using balance transfers to move debt from accounts with higher balances to those with lower balances, or by simply paying off some of your higher balances.

Take the necessary steps to fix any mistakes that you see on your credit reports by filing an official dispute. Draft a letter to reporting agencies disputing negative entries and also submit any available documentation. Mail your dispute packet with receipt confirmation so you will have proof the agency has received it.

One of the most stressful aspects of handling bad credit is dealing with debt collection agencies. Consumers can legally issue letters to collection agencies to cease and desist if they are being harassed. These letters will discourage contact from collection agencies. The consumer still has to pay disputed debts even though these letters stop agencies from calling.
